WebNov 19, 2024 · What Is the Escrow Period? The days and weeks in between the contract signing and the closing (which date is usually specified in the contract) is in most U.S. states referred to as the "escrow period." It usually lasts between 30 and 60 days (or less if the buyer pays all cash for the property). WebAug 11, 2024 · In the majority of cases, the escrow process proceeds as follows: The buyer and seller agree to the terms of the sale or purchase of real estate; Either the buyer or the seller opens escrow; Both parties send all contract documentation to escrow; The buyer will deposit their earnest money deposit into escrow; WebThe escrow or settlement agent oversees closing of the transaction. The seller signs the deed and closing affidavit. The buyer signs the new note and mortgage. The old loan is paid off. The seller, real estate agents, attorneys and other parties present at the closing of the transaction are paid.
